Output 7330618d808fb76b145b38122ad9fdd04dbea0bc0e487b128ae0f6a5e91f992f:81

value
39339
script pubkey
OP_0 OP_PUSHBYTES_20 42984376661d94f8985b10796ea8f5c9da233b17
address
bc1qg2vyxanxrk203xzmzpuka284e8dzxwchg6uuxt
transaction
7330618d808fb76b145b38122ad9fdd04dbea0bc0e487b128ae0f6a5e91f992f
spent
true